Output 3e57996e3d0e9affe71d08a2b0fca5a8bffb0cfa6a93a4c70703b44badb05843:3

value
19632992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4394f321ada015ba63756514bf1246bcc61bf6ee OP_EQUAL
address
ME4VwVUH3i5cUNkZTtRwHQcBNx3LAhap4s
transaction
3e57996e3d0e9affe71d08a2b0fca5a8bffb0cfa6a93a4c70703b44badb05843
spent
true